Some Local HOT SPOTS: Must-Visit Shops, Restaurants, Hot Spots & Activities in Ronald, Roslyn, and Cle Elum

RONALD

The Last Resort: Gear up for adventure with snowmobile, jet ski, kayak, canoe, paddle board, and pontoon boat rentals. Also offers RV sites, motel accommodations, a convenience store, and fuel.

Coal Miners Memorial: A local landmark honoring the area’s mining history.

Cle Elum Lake & Speelyi Beach: Perfect for kayaking, paddle boarding, and lakeside relaxation. Access is just a mile from the cabin.

Hex Mountain Trail: Popular for hiking and snowshoeing with stunning panoramic views.

ROSLYN

Roslyn Historical Museum: Dive into the town’s rich mining and immigrant history.

Roslyn Candy Company: A charming shop for handmade sweets and gifts.

The Brick Saloon: Washington’s oldest continuously operating bar—famous for its swinging doors and lively atmosphere.

Roslyn Theatre: Historic and cozy spot for catching a movie.

Roslyn Farmers Market: Seasonal market with local produce, crafts, and treats.

Roslyn Cafe: Iconic eatery with classic American fare and a famous mural.

Roots BBQ: Popular for smoky barbecue and casual bites.

Roslyn Village Pizza: Local favorite for pizza lovers.

Roslyn Mexican Grill: Tasty Mexican cuisine with vegetarian and vegan options.

Basecamp Books and Bites: Bookstore and café for coffee, snacks, and souvenirs.

Swiftwater Cellars: Winery, restaurant, and event venue with beautiful views.

CLE ELUM

Carek's Meat Market: Local steakhouse and butcher for hearty meals.

Owen's Meats: Popular meat market, rivaling Carek's

The Red Bird Cafe: Cozy spot for breakfast, soups, and homemade treats.

Washington State Horse Park: Horseback riding, events, and scenic trails.

Centennial Park & Fireman's Park: Great for picnics, walking, and outdoor play.

Teanaway Community Forest: Hiking, biking, and wildlife viewing in a scenic setting.

Cle Elum Riverfront Park: Riverside trails and picnic areas.

Glade Spring Spa: Relax with a massage or spa treatment at Suncadia Resort.

Suncadia Resort: Golf, spa, dining, and year-round activities.

Outdoor Activities (All Areas)

Hiking: Hex Mountain, Swauk Forest Discovery Trail, and nearby Teanaway and Okanogan-Wenatchee National Forests.

Biking: Local trails and forest roads.

Fishing: Cle Elum River, Cooper Lake, and area streams.

Snowmobiling & Sledding: Direct access from Ronald and Roslyn; rentals available at The Last Resort.

Boating & Paddle Sports: Cle Elum Lake, Cooper Lake, and Yakima River.

Wine Tasting: Swiftwater Cellars.

Unique Experiences

Roslyn Ridge Activity Center: Pool and recreation for families.

Heritage Distilling Co.: Craft spirits and tasting room in Roslyn.

Boutique Shopping: Explore unique shops and galleries in downtown Roslyn and Cle Elum.
